The Hanover Insurance Group Inc. named Gary Y. Kusumi president of the company’s personal lines business.
Kusumi will oversee the Worcester, Massachusetts-based company’s personal lines operations, including products, pricing, service and underwriting strategies, as well as growth and profitability. Kusumi will work out of The Hanover’s headquarters and will serve as a member of the company’s executive leadership team.
Kusumi comes to The Hanover from GMAC Insurance, where he served as president and chief executive officer of the company’s personal lines business. Previously, Kusumi served as president and chief executive officer of the Windsor Group, and president of Leader National Group-personal lines companies of Great American Insurance Group, in Cincinnati, Ohio. Prior to that, Mr. Kusumi served in various senior management roles for the Progressive Cos., in Cleveland, Ohio.
He is also the past chairman of the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ety, and served on the safety advisory committee for the United States Secretary of Transportation.
